Watch: Ajay Devgn Drops Glimpse Of ‘Golmaal 5’ With “The Boys” From Ooty Schedule
Ajay Devgn shared a clip from Golmaal 5’s Ooty shoot, reuniting the gang and bringing back the iconic bike.
The hills of Ooty just witnessed a massive dose of comedy and chaos as the cast and crew of ‘Golmaal 5’ officially wrapped up a major filming schedule. Ajay Devgn took to social media to share a high-energy glimpse from the sets, sending fans into a nostalgic frenzy. The latest update confirms that filmmaker Rohit Shetty is pulling out all the stops to ensure that the fifth installment of this blockbuster franchise is bigger and better than ever before.

Ajay Devgn shared a vibrant behind-the-scenes video today, featuring the core ‘Golmaal’ gang against the lush, green backdrop of the Nilgiri trees. In a nod to the franchise's signature slapstick style, the video prominently featured the iconic multi-seater bike – a symbol that has been synonymous with the series since its inception.

Accompanying the clip, Ajay wrote, “Iss baar sawaari badi hai, aur entertainment usse bhi zyada bada hoga #Golmaal5 Ooty schedule with the boys.” The post instantly went viral, garnering thousands of likes and comments from fans who have been eagerly waiting for the return of Gopal, Madhav, Lucky, and the rest of the crew.
Arshad Warsi also shared the update on his Instagram handle, “Ooty schedule wrap with the Boys/Men !! Golmaal 5!!!!!”
One of the biggest highlights of ‘Golmaal 5’ is the return of the original ensemble. The Ooty wrap featured Arshad Warsi, Tusshar Kapoor, Shreyas Talpade, and Kunal Kemmu. However, the most talked-about return is that of Sharman Joshi, who was part of the very first film, ‘Golmaal: Fun Unlimited’ (2006), but was absent from the subsequent sequels. His homecoming to the franchise has added an extra layer of excitement for long-time viewers.
Director Rohit Shetty also shared the same video montage, reflecting on the two-decade-long journey of the series. He noted that the team has been “riding through positive vibes” since 2006, highlighting the enduring camaraderie that has made the ‘Golmaal’ series one of Hindi cinema's most reliable comedy brands.
While the original gang provides the nostalgia, the fifth installment is set to introduce a fresh dynamic with the inclusion of Akshay Kumar. The actor, who was officially announced as part of the project on Rohit Shetty’s birthday (March 14, 2026), is reportedly set to play the antagonist. Early BTS footage has teased Akshay in a striking bald look, further fuelling speculation about his character's role in the chaotic universe of ‘Golmaal’.
In a humorous exchange during the announcement, Ajay Devgn even quipped, "Koi franchise nahi chhodta hai ye,” referencing Akshay's knack for joining successful film series.
The ‘Golmaal’ franchise has remained a box-office powerhouse for nearly twenty years. Starting with ‘Golmaal: Fun Unlimited’ in 2006, the series expanded with ‘Golmaal Returns’ (2008), ‘Golmaal 3’ (2010), and the supernatural-themed ‘Golmaal Again’ (2017). Each film has managed to raise the stakes in terms of scale and ensemble cast, and ‘Golmaal 5’ appears to be following that successful blueprint.
With the Ooty schedule now in the bag, the production is moving forward at a brisk pace.
